We're Not Nuns!

Column: Outing the Goddess Within
.

My saddest moment in sharing the goddess sister love, is witnessing the anger that some women refuse to release in a healthy way. Instead they sulk, radiate dark energy and unsubscribe from newsletters with comments like "too much god dam (sic) advertising."

I received one such note like this during the week and it really pushed my buttons. With the thousands of resources available based on the Law of Attraction, get-wealthy-now schemes, holistic abundance techniques and the Law of Benevolence, why is it that some women still aren't understanding that it's OK to be prosperous?

Man I get peeved at the persistent poverty consciousness that some women wrap around themselves like a familiar old blanket. On this occasion, I got so frustrated I included the following open letter in my last newsletter.


Dear Goddess Sister,

I don't get many women unsubscribing from this list, but when I do, I am heartened at the frequency of the thank-you notes unsubscribers leave as they embark on a new chapter of their return to Self.
 
However, occasionally I get a parting note citing "advertising" as the reason for an unsubscription. This attitude saddens me, mainly because it's a woman telling me I don't deserve to try making a living doing that which I love.

Goddess sisters, don't you know that every single one of us deserves to make a living from her passion? If you are not living, loving and laughing each day, what are you doing?
 
Making a living from that which you love, which strikes the chords of your heart and fires the song in your throat, is the most wonderful act of self-love. It's the most beautiful way to honour your divine purpose. And if you're really lucky, it's the single-most rewarding way to earn abundance.
 
Now, being transparent here, I do need to advertise my beautiful products and services through this newsletter. Sadly, ISPs, web-hosts, service providers and electrical companies don't accept karmic coins as payment ;-) That aside, each year I pump thousands of dollars of my own earnings into this service in order to see it grow and reach the women who need to connect with the messages. I don't count the money out of my pocket as a loss. I count it as an investment in the world-wide return of balance, love and self-honouring acts by women.
 
So if you're ever tempted to complain about "product placement" in free newsletters or web-sites around the world, stop for a moment... what limiting belief prevents you from living your passion, and from supporting a goddess sister in her quest to live hers?
 
Love, love, love, (and a kiss for every dollar this newsletter generates, ha ha), Anita
